Yoplait Seeks Breast Cancer 'Champions'
General Mills has begun its second annual search for breast cancer survivors as part of its Yoplait Champions program.
The fall effort is a joint promotion with the Susan G. Komen Breast Cancer Foundation and Self Magazine. Consumers go to Yoplaitusa.com to nominate themselves or a friend who has fought breast cancer or worked on behalf of cancer patients. Yoplait will choose 25 Yoplait Champions and donate $1,000 to each champion's charity of choice.
Nominations are accepted Sept. 19 through Oct. 31; entrants submit an essay describing their nominees' sustained commitment to fighting breast cancer. Cause marketing shop Cone Communications, Boston, handles.
The search dovetails with Yoplait's eighth annual Save Lids to Save Lives promotion that puts pink lids on yogurt cartons to trigger donations to the Komen Foundation. Consumers collect lids, then mail them to General Mills by yearend; Minneapolis-based Mills will donate 10 cents per lid, up to $1.5 million (with a minimum donation of $500,000).
